According to the graph, the top export goods from Azerbaijan to Bangladesh in 2021 were intermediate goods, with a total value of $268.184 million. These goods play a crucial role in the production process of final goods and services, making them essential for industries in both countries. The main products in this category include chemicals, machinery parts, and electronic components.
Exports of intermediate goods are vital to Azerbaijan's economy as they contribute significantly to the country's export revenue. These goods are often produced in regions such as Baku, Ganja, and Sumgait, where there is a high concentration of manufacturing and industrial activity. The export of intermediate goods also strengthens Azerbaijan's trade relations with Bangladesh, helping to diversify and expand its export markets.
In Bangladesh, these intermediate goods are crucial for industries such as textiles, manufacturing, and electronics. The country relies on imports of these goods from countries like Azerbaijan to support its growing economy and meet the demands of its domestic production. Regions in Bangladesh where these goods are in high demand include Dhaka, Chittagong, and Khulna, where many factories and production facilities are located. Importing these goods helps Bangladesh to enhance its industrial capacity and drive economic growth.
Over the past 30 years, the trade between Azerbaijan and Bangladesh has seen significant changes and developments. The total value of all product exports from Azerbaijan to Bangladesh has fluctuated over the years, with a steady increase from 1992 to 1997, followed by a slight decline in the late 1990s. The trade then saw a significant surge in 2000, with a peak in 2004, before experiencing a drop in 2005. From 2006 onwards, the trade has been relatively stable, with some fluctuations in between. The highest value recorded was in 2017 at 950.124 million US dollars, showing a substantial growth compared to the initial years.
The main product groups exported from Azerbaijan to Bangladesh include oil and gas products, machinery, cotton, textiles, and food products. Oil and gas products have been the dominant export category, accounting for a significant portion of the total export value. Machinery and textiles have also been prominent exports, showcasing the diversity of goods exchanged between the two countries. As trade continues to evolve, both Azerbaijan and Bangladesh have the opportunity to further strengthen their economic ties and explore new avenues for collaboration in various industries.
Baku Port: Baku Port is the largest and busiest port in Azerbaijan, located on the western shore of the Caspian Sea. It serves as a major hub for both commercial and container shipping in the region. The port handles a wide range of cargo including oil, gas, construction materials, and general goods. Baku Port is equipped with modern facilities and infrastructure to handle large vessels and has a storage capacity of over 15 million tons. It plays a crucial role in facilitating trade between Azerbaijan and other countries, particularly those in Europe and Asia.
In addition to Baku Port, there are several other important ports in Azerbaijan including:
Sumgayit Port: Situated on the Absheron Peninsula, Sumgayit Port is a key maritime gateway for the transportation of bulk cargo such as chemicals, grains, and fertilizers. The port has modern facilities for loading and unloading cargo and plays a significant role in the country's industrial and economic development.
Alat Port: Located near Baku, Alat Port is a strategic hub for container shipping and logistics in Azerbaijan. The port has state-of-the-art container terminals and warehousing facilities, making it a major transit point for cargo moving between Europe and Asia. Alat Port is connected to the national railway network, providing seamless transportation links for goods moving to and from the port.
Lagan Port: Lagan Port is a smaller port located on the Caspian Sea coast, primarily handling fishing vessels and small cargo ships. The port serves the local fishing industry and also plays a role in supporting the region's tourism sector, as it is a popular destination for recreational boating and water sports.
Astara Port: Situated on the border with Iran, Astara Port is an important link for trade between Azerbaijan and its southern neighbor. The port handles a variety of goods including oil, agricultural products, and consumer goods. Astara Port is part of the North-South Transport Corridor, a key transit route connecting Russia, Iran, and India.
Neftchala Port: Neftchala Port is a small port on the Caspian Sea coast, primarily used for the transportation of oil and gas products. The port supports the country's energy sector by providing a vital link for the export of petroleum products to international markets.
Chittagong Port: Chittagong Port is the largest seaport in Bangladesh and handles about 90% of the country's import-export business. It is located on the southeastern coast of the country and serves as a major gateway for trade with other countries. The port has modern container handling facilities and is equipped to handle a wide range of cargo, including bulk cargo, containerized cargo, and dry bulk cargo.
Dhaka Port: Dhaka Port is the second largest port in Bangladesh and is located on the Buriganga River in the capital city of Dhaka. It primarily handles domestic cargo and serves as an important hub for trade within the country. The port has facilities for handling bulk cargo, containers, and general cargo.
Mongla Port: Mongla Port is the second largest seaport in Bangladesh and is located on the southwestern coast of the country. It serves as an important gateway for trade with India and other neighboring countries. The port handles a wide range of cargo, including bulk cargo, containerized cargo, and project cargo.
Chalna Port: Chalna Port, also known as Khalishpur Port, is a river port located on the Pusur River in southwestern Bangladesh. It primarily handles bulk cargo, such as grain, oil, and cement. The port also has facilities for handling containerized cargo and general cargo.
Other ports in Bangladesh include: Mongla River Port, Narayanganj Port, Ashuganj River Port, and Barisal River Port.

For container transportation from Azerbaijan to Bangladesh, various factors come into play. The size of the shipping container, the type of goods to be shipped, distance of the destination, and the shipping method (either Full Container Load or Less than Container Load) all directly affect the cost.
The average transit time for shipping cargo from Azerbaijan to Bangladesh via sea freight typically ranges from 15 to 30 days. The exact duration can vary depending on various factors such as the distance between the two countries, the specific ports of departure and arrival, the type of cargo being transported, as well as any potential delays due to weather conditions, customs clearance, or other logistical issues. Additionally, the choice of shipping line and the frequency of sailings can also impact the overall transit time.
When it comes to customs procedures, both Azerbaijan and Bangladesh have their own set of regulations and requirements that need to be followed when importing goods. On average, customs clearance in Azerbaijan can take anywhere from 2 to 7 days, depending on the complexity of the shipment and any additional documentation required. In comparison, customs clearance in Bangladesh may take a similar amount of time, with an average delay of 3 to 8 days.
